If you’re looking to dive into the world of Python programming but feel overwhelmed by the sheer amount of resources available, "Master Python Visually: A Complete A-Z Bootcamp for Beginners" on Udemy presents a structured and user-friendly option. This course simplifies learning by focusing on visual aids and relatable examples, making it an excellent choice for those starting their coding journey.
What you’ll learn
By the end of this course, you will have a solid foundation in Python, covering a variety of crucial topics and skills essential for programming. Key learning outcomes include:
- Basic Syntax and Data Types: Understand fundamental components such as variables, strings, numbers, lists, tuples, and dictionaries.
- Control Structures: Learn how to implement conditions and loops, such as if-elif-else statements and for/while loops, which are vital for any programmed logic.
- Functions and Modules: Get acquainted with creating reusable code through functions and utilizing modules to enhance your programming toolkit.
- File Handling: Discover how to read from and write to files, enabling you to handle data effectively.
- Object-Oriented Programming (OOP): Explore the basic concepts of OOP, including classes and objects, to write more modular and maintainable code.
- Visual Programming Techniques: Engage with colorful visuals and diagrams that enhance retention and understanding, perfect for visual learners.
This comprehensive curriculum offers an engaging pathway to mastering Python, equipping you with the skills needed to tackle real-world problems.
Requirements and course approach
The course is designed with beginners in mind, yet it still offers value for intermediate learners looking to refresh their knowledge. There are no strict prerequisites; however, having a computer with internet access is necessary to follow along with the coding exercises. The course is structured into bite-sized sections that allow you to progress at your own pace.
The approach is highly visual, utilizing diagrams, flowcharts, and engaging examples that clarify complex concepts. Each module is filled with practical exercises, quizzes, and coding challenges to reinforce your newly acquired skills. This hands-on methodology ensures that you are not just passively consuming information but actively engaging in learning.
Who this course is for
This course caters to a diverse audience, including:
- Complete Beginners: If you have no prior experience in programming, this course is tailored to help you start from scratch.
- Non-IT Students: Those from non-technical backgrounds will find the visual learning style particularly effective for grasping programming concepts.
- Professionals Seeking a Career Change: Individuals interested in transitioning to tech roles will benefit from the foundational skills that this Python bootcamp provides.
- Hobbyists: Anyone simply wanting to learn Python for personal projects or interests will discover valuable content that meets their needs.
With its inclusive design, this course aims to empower anyone willing to learn, regardless of their previous exposure to coding.
Outcomes and final thoughts
Upon completing "Master Python Visually: A Complete A-Z Bootcamp for Beginners," you will not only have a thorough understanding of Python but will feel confident in applying your skills to real-world scenarios. By mastering key concepts, you’ll be well-prepared to undertake projects or even advance to more complex programming curricula.
In summary, this course provides an invaluable resource for anyone eager to embark on the journey of learning Python. Its visual approach, combined with practical exercises, ensures that the learning experience is both effective and enjoyable. Whether you’re looking to start a new career in tech, enhance your skill set, or simply explore a new hobby, this bootcamp is a fantastic stepping stone into the programming world.